Features Centralized Server Configuration Management, Improved On Audio Support
and Advanced Integration Capabilities.
Woodbridge, NJ—April 10, 2012 Intelligent Security Systems (ISS), a leader in video management and image analytic software, announced today that they have released SecurOS Version 7.0. The new version has a number of key advantages, including centralized server configuration management option, easy to add on audio support, and advanced integration capabilities related to various devices. It also includes Real-time Transport Protocol (RTP)/Real-time Streaming Protocol (RTSP), a new event filtering module, direct 3D technology, and Open Network Video Interface Forum (ONVIF) compatibility.

With SecurOS 7.0, server configuration is designed to support large-scale distributed systems. With the centralized management of SecurOS 7.0, configurations can be changed from any computer, so the most recent changes are reflected throughout the system and create no conflict when communicating with other related servers (a consistent problem with ad hoc approaches).
Audio support can be added to devices without having to reinstall SecurOS software, due to a special plug-in integrated device pack, which automatically integrates audio and improves sound support for a number of previously integrated devices.
SecurOS 7.0 has a universal "driver" that allows cameras that may not have yet integrated SecurOS software to be connected and provide video support for the devices via RTP / RTSP. It makes no restrictions on the number and range of IP devices that can be supported, including video analytics functions. The number of supported cameras is very wide and continues to grow.
Through a new and improved Software Development Kit (SDK) devices can be integrated and operated without direction interaction with the hardware.
SecurOS 7.0 is immediately available on a worldwide basis.
About Intelligent Security Systems (ISS)
ISS, headquartered in Woodbridge, NJ, and with offices worldwide, is a leader in video management and analytic software, and provides a comprehensive line of digital security and surveillance video solutions. They are on the forefront of on-demand security, which allows for centralized command and control of an entire enterprise security network.
Smart video subsystems include Face Capture & Recognition, Traffic Monitoring, Transit & Cargo Container Recognition, License Plate Recognition, and Object Tracking, as well as dedicated solutions for POS (shrinkage detection) and ATM systems. ISS has successfully deployed over 100,000 systems in command of over 1.5 million cameras worldwide.
